What Is Erectile Dysfunction?
Erectile dysfunction, also referred to as impotence, is when a man is unable to achieve or maintain an erection the penis that is sufficient to ensure the satisfaction of both the partners. Although most men over the age of 40 have occasionally ED there are as high as 15% of men living in India suffer from it frequently. Most men seeking treatment for ED get some relief.

Erectile Dysfunction in Old Men
The causes of erection issues in older males typically involve blood vessels. The most frequent causes of ED for older men are physical issues that restrict circulation of blood to penis. This includes hardening of the arteries as well as diabetes. Another cause of physical erectile problems could be a malfunctioning vein that doesn’t hold the penis’s blood supply. The hormonal imbalance, certain surgeries or other issues could be the cause of ED.
The blood process that leads to an erection is controlled by the nervous system. Certain prescription medications can disrupt nerve signals that hinder the erection from taking place. These include stimulants, antihistamines and diuretics, sedatives and medications to treat depression or high blood pressure or cancer. Erectile Dysfunction Diagnosis
If you speak to the physician about the ED symptoms, they’ll look to determine the source of your medical issue that is responsible for the issue. They will inquire regarding your medical history, and will ask questions about your .
A few of the diagnostic tests that are performed by the doctor include:
A physical test includes the assessment of your penis as well as testicles.
Tests for urine and blood that test for issues such as heart disease, diabetes and low testosterone levels.
A mental health examination can be conducted to determine whether you suffer from depression, anxiety or any other conditions that could trigger ED.
An ultrasound test can enable your doctor to determine whether any circulatory issues are affected by your penis.

Vacuum device
Also known as a penis pumps this tubing sits onto your penis. It has a pump which is used to pull air out of the tube. The pump draws the blood from your penis and makes it stand up. Once your penis has become erect then you can put an elastic ring on the penis’s base to ensure it stays erect. You can then remove the vacuum tube.
